CONVERSION OF CARS
lSf-Year Boy't Offences Charged with the unlawful conversion of four motor-cars, a youth aged 15$ appeared before Mr J. Miller, S.M., in the Children 's Court at Napier this morning. Accused admitted the cbarges, and also confessed to four pther ca&es in which tho cars had been retqfned to tho places from where they were taken. After being warned the youth was placed under the supeiwision of the Child Welfare Offieer for twelve months.
